Output 39044d5efd54e8f27ecbafb5266d5f05069e1bcdeaa269c35032ec4382ee82c5:0

value
17629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2388f3985dcb500ef815f238cd2b61b58cec62ab OP_EQUAL
address
34vudpPeDw7cFx3EhT7EFhvmUrWszzUz3q
transaction
39044d5efd54e8f27ecbafb5266d5f05069e1bcdeaa269c35032ec4382ee82c5